Love her or hate her, Lady Gaga has a strong presence in fashion as of late. From gracing the cover of March’s Vogue US to receiving a CFDA award, the pop songtress has been welcomed by the fashion it crowd and her latest contribution to the industry can be found in i-D’s spring 2011 issue. Lensed by Mariano Vivanco and styled by Nicola Formichetti, Gaga is as bold as ever with painted horns and edgy fashion.
